A Deep Dive into Oral Steroid Mechanisms of Action
Oral steroids, synthetic analogs mimicking cortisol, exert remarkable influence on various physiological processes through a complex cascade of molecular interactions. Primarily, these agents bind to intracellular glucocorticoid receptors, creating a receptor-ligand complex that translocates to the nucleus. This complex then affects specific DNA sequences, modulating the transcription of target genes involved in numerous cellular functions.
- Among these functions are energy production, protein synthesis and degradation, inflammation regulation, and immune response modulation.
- Moreover, oral steroids can also influence gene expression through non-genomic mechanisms, acting through signaling pathways independent excluding DNA binding.
Understanding these intricate mechanisms of action is crucial for both harnessing the therapeutic benefits of oral steroids and mitigating their potential adverse effects.
Addressing Side Effects Associated with Oral Steroid Therapy
Oral steroid therapy can be highly effective in treating a diverse range of conditions. However, it's important to recognize that steroids can cause certain side effects. These effects can vary from person to person and depend on the level of steroids used, as well as the period of treatment.
Frequent side effects associated with oral steroid therapy include weight gain, fluid retention, increased blood pressure, muscle weakness, and mood swings. To reduce the risk of these side effects, it's crucial to adhere to your doctor's instructions carefully.
